I forgot Oil in the macros of the video
Macros: 882 calories, 107C, 28F, 58P
1 burger bun 200 calories
180g ground beef 95/5
1/2 yellow onion
30g pickles
50g tomato
6g oil
15g light mayo
15g zero sugar added ketchup
1 slice american cheese 60 calories
Salt
350g peeled potatoes
1/4 tsp each onion powder, garlic powder, cayenne pepper, paprika, black pepper
1/4 tsp baking soda
Salt
Peel potatoes, slice them into a kind of french fries shape, and add them to a pot. Fill the pot with water until potatoes are covered, then add a strong pinch of salt and baking soda. Let the potatoes simmer on medium heat for 8 minutes. Drain the water and add potatoes to a bowl. Add a bit of oil and seasoning and give the potatoes a shake.
Transfer potatoes to an air fryer or oven at 200°C or 400°F for 20 minutes.
In the meantime prepare all burger ingredients and dice the vegetables. Split the beef into 2 portions and form 2 burger balls. Season them with salt and prepare 2 pieces of parchment paper per burger.
Start by frying the onions for 2-3 minutes with a pinch of salt in a cast iron pan with a bit of oil. Toast the buns for 20 seconds to get them lightly toasted.
Add a bit of il and then the burger balls with the parchment paper on top. Now take a spatula and anything heavy like a water bottle. Press down the beef balls until they are super thin. After 45-60 seconds flip both burgers and add a slice of American cheese on top. After another 45-60 seconds place the beef patty without the cheese on top of the patty with the cheese so it can melt and remove from the heat.
Build the burger. Add ketchup and mayo on top of the bottom bun, then the onions, the beef patties, the pickles, and the tomatoes. Lastly, add another bit of ketchup and mayo and top with the bun. Wrap the burger in aluminum foil for 3-4 minutes so the steam can make the burger soft.
The fries should be ready now, so add them to a plate and add additional seasoning if you want and enjoy your meal!
